About Air Liquide
Air Liquide is a French multinational company and a world leader in gases, technologies and services to various industries including medical, chemical and electronic manufactures. Having presence in 60 countries, the organization serves over 4 million customers and patients. Air Liquide embodies scientific territory and oxygen, nitrogen and hydrogen (essential small molecules for life matter and energy) have been at the core of the company's activities since 1902.
Samantha Rochetti, a seasoned professional in the benefits industry, transitioned into her role at Air Liquide nearly 5 years ago with a focus on enhancing employee well-being and reducing healthcare costs. Recognizing the high MSK and diabetes-related costs, particularly those associated with back issues and the need for surgeries, as well as high pharmacy costs related to GLP1s and other diabetic medications, Samantha sought a solution that could address these challenges effectively.
Understanding the Unique Challenges of a Shift Workforce
Air Liquide has a goal to stay ahead of trends and be able to provide innovative benefits for its employees. They want to be able to support its primarily remote workforce, who typically work non-traditional shift hours, with access to benefits, but also benefits that support claims reduction.
Given their diverse workforce, which is made up of a small corporate employee base and the majority of shift workers in the field for gasses tech and services, communication is a top challenge. “We have difficulty communicating company-wide messages so we rely heavily on managers to help communicate, especially to our front line employees,” Samantha mentioned.
Samantha also shared that they have a difficult time reaching spouses who are on their insurance plan. “Many of our employees are men, and their spouses tend to handle the administrative work at home, making it crucial for us to be able to engage both employees and their families about our benefits programs.”
MSK claims is the number two expenditure for the company, totaling $3.2M. They have another 30 approved MSK disability claims, which has resulted in another $280K spend. On top of the hard dollar spend, Samantha mentioned that employees have missed a total of 1,853 days combined from MSK related injuries.
From Implementation to Impact: A Collaborative Success Story
In early 2023, Air Liquide partnered with Hinge Health, drawn by its home-based, cost-effective model that perfectly suited their diverse, primarily remote workforce. "Our consultants presented Hinge Health to us, and I was immediately intrigued. The program's accessibility from anywhere was particularly appealing given our shift workers, for whom traditional rehab center visits aren't always practical,” said Samantha.
Samantha also mentioned that the billing model was another factor in why they decided to go with Health Hinge as their MSK vendor. She mentioned, “It was a big thing for us to not have a monthly fee. We want to be able to offer our employees the best benefits, but we also need to ensure it’s worth it for us as well.”
The implementation was remarkably smooth, with Samantha noting it was "probably the smoothest transition of a new benefit" she'd experienced. This seamless integration was partly due to Hinge Health's existing partnership with Air Liquide's PBM, which eliminated the need to consider other vendors.
To ensure successful adoption, Samantha leveraged the open enrollment period to highlight Hinge Health alongside other significant benefits changes in a large campaign. The communication strategy included:
Mailers: Detailed information about Hinge Health was sent to all employees.
Presentations: Held outside work hours to engage employees and their spouses, ensuring everyone understood the new programs.
Emphasis on Convenience: The ease of using Hinge Health from home without needing a doctor's visit was strongly emphasized.
For year two, Samatha really focused on highlighting the Women’s Pelvic Health program, especially since a lot of women spouses are on their plan. “I tried to bring some humor to engage our employees, specifically our male employees who have their female spouses on our health plan. I wanted them to understand the importance and why they should encourage their spouses to sign up.”
The partnership has already yielded impressive results:
High Engagement: 9.8% of total eligible lives engaged with the program.
Habit Formation: Engagement increased year after year.
Pain Reduction: 58% average pain reduction within the first 90 days.
Mental Health Improvements: 64% reduction in both anxiety and depression related to chronic pain.
Member Satisfaction: 8.5/10 satisfaction rate.
